Autumn driving tips

Watch out for those leaves

The leaves that add to the beauty of the season can be dangerous, as they can be extremely slippery. At times, they can also cover potholes and when wet, they can make the roads surface like a skid pad, so avoid going over them and if you have to, just slow down. The morning frost can also add to this, not allowing enough traction.

Wet roads

Most places are wet during this season and wet roads are a danger whether you’re on two wheels or four. Again, slow down and if you do see a patch of water, do reduce your speed further, as aquaplaning is highly dangerous. Aquaplaning happens when the tyres do not make enough contact with the road due to water, which can at times be fatal. Also, such wet and cold conditions don’t let tyres get to optimal temperatures fast, so slow down.

Low visibility

Visibility is a key factor and it is usually low during autumn. There can be animals, pedestrians, or obstacles on the way and the lack of visibility can cause more damage than one can think of. Take your time, ensure to turn on the defogger, and drive slowly. Low visibility can also lead to other forms of accidents if one’s not familiar with the roads.
